We are seeking a talented Network Support Technician to join our Information Technology team. This position will assist in further developing our IT infrastructure by developing & leading progressive hardware and software implementations.
Job Tasks and Responsibilities
- Maintain, troubleshoot and administer the use of local network operations and remote locations.
- Setup, configure and install new workstations, servers, and other equipment (i.e. barcode scanners, receipt printers, etc.)
- Provide technical support and training to end-users
- Evaluate and manage software updates and licensing on computer workstations and servers.
- Enforce and implement data, software and hardware security policies and procedures
- Perform and verify data backups and disaster recovery operations
- Schedule, manage, and recommend software and hardware improvements and upgrades
- Document and maintain accurate representations of the network environment and infrastructure
- Ensuring the smooth running of all IT systems, including Servers, Anti-Virus/Spyware Protection, Data Security/Backups, and Email (99.7% average uptime over 5 years)
- Handle annual capital budget / operating requirements and ensure cost effectiveness
- Plan, organize, evaluate, and rollout Infrastructure upgrades and changes
- Manage / Support IT Helpdesk
- Support and maintain corporate Active Directory and related technologies including group policy
- Troubleshoot hardware and software issues related to IT
- Create and Manage SOPs (Standard Operating Procedure) documents related to all use of company Hardware/Software
- Oversee the IT set-up of new hires and equipment return for employee departures
- Plan, organize and execute infrastructure upgrades and changes
- Administer SQL management studio (backups, queries etc)
